Empathy, a messaging program that supports text, voice and video chat, and file transfers over many different protocols, is now at version 3.8.2.

Empathy 3.8.2 uses Telepathy for protocol and the user interface is based on Gossip. The Empathy messenger is also the default chat client in current versions of GNOME.

The application supports all major protocols, including Google Talk (Jabber/XMPP), MSN, IRC, Salut, AIM, Facebook, Yahoo, and more.

Highlights of Empathy 3.8.2:

• The call-window now remembers that the audio output has been added; • The build has been fixed by adding a missing math.h header; • online-accounts-preferences no longer crashes when the accounts need access to the main app.
